excel:如何根据条件生成学号

2024-09-09 23:59:43
教育小百科
教育小百科认证

教育小百科为您分享以下优质知识

第一行标题,A学校名称,B年级 ,C班级,D姓名,E学号

为了自动生成编号,需要建立辅助的对照表:

在G:H列建立辅助列:G列学校名,H列编号(1-2位数字)

在J:K列建立辅助列:J列年级,K列编号(2位数字)

在M:N列建立辅助列:M列班级,N列编号(2位数字)

****这是为了说明问题,也可以在不同的工作表中分别建立三个索引表

E2公式如下

=VLOOKUP(B2,J:K,2,0)&"07"&TEXT(VLOOKUP(A2,G:H,2,0),"00")&"?"&VLOOKUP(C2,M:N,2,0)&TEXT(ROW(1:1),"00")

下拉填充

****题目中说“第一二位:由年级而定”“第七位:年级”是不是搞错了,我先用问号代替了。

这个表可以做的更规范,ABC列都可以用下拉条来选择。

图太大就不传了,如果需要给你EXCEL文件